What is CWE-918?
CWE-918 (Server-Side Request Forgery (SSRF)) is a weakness category in the Common Weakness Enumeration (CWE) system maintained by MITRE. It describes a class of software or hardware vulnerability that can lead to security issues.
How many CVEs are classified as CWE-918?
There are 3,755 CVE records associated with CWE-918 in our database. Of these, 428 are critical severity, 1157 are high severity, and 1478 are medium severity.
How can I protect against CWE-918 vulnerabilities?
Protection strategies depend on the specific weakness type. General measures include input validation, secure coding practices, regular security testing, and keeping software up to date.
